A leading teaching practice in Reading, West Berkshire is seeking an experienced Practice Nurse to join their dedicated team. Serving over 32,000 patients, including more than 9,000 students, this practice is recognised for its innovative approach to healthcare and outstanding patient care, having achieved "Outstanding" in their last two CQC audits.

What They Offer:

  • Salary:40,000 - 48,750 per annum with an extensive benefits package including personal development opportunities (CPD leave entitlement) and much more.
  • Full-time or part-time role
  • Commitment to training and development, with support for any additional training required.
  • A collaborative and supportive working environment where innovation is encouraged.

Role Overview: As a Practice Nurse, you will be responsible for delivering high-quality nursing care to patients while working closely with GPs and the wider clinical team. Key duties include:

  • Patient Care Tasks: Cytology, wound care, NHS health checks, travel clinic, minor ailment management, immunisations, and more.
  • Specialist Interests: Diabetes, asthma, coronary heart disease, and contraception.
  • Clinical Support: Assisting GPs with minor surgeries, performing ECGs, spirometry, and managing hypertension.
  • Team Collaboration: Work effectively within a multidisciplinary team to meet patient needs and contribute to the ongoing development of services.

Additional Responsibilities:

  • Maintaining a clean, organised treatment room in line with infection control policies.
  • Stock management for treatment rooms, vaccinations, and health promotion literature.
  • Participation in practice and CCG-led training, meetings, and audits.
  • Contributing to quality improvement and risk management initiatives.
